    In the rapidly expanding concrete jungles of the modern world, urban green spaces—parks, gardens, and tree-lined streets—are becoming more vital than ever. These areas provide city dwellers with a much-needed respite from the fast-paced urban environment, offering places for relaxation, recreation, and connection with nature. Beyond their aesthetic appeal, green spaces play a critical role in improving the quality of life for city residents by enhancing both physical and mental health

    Software Giant Faces Stock Tumult Despite Financial Beacon

    Pegasystems reported a 3.5% increase in revenue year-on-year, reaching $490.8 million, surpassing analysts’ expectations by 4.4%. Despite exceeding revenue forecasts, the company’s shares fell by over 5% due to lower-than-expected full-year earnings projections.     Reddit Soars in Revenue, But Stock Takes a Plunge. Here’s Why.

    Reddit achieved a notable 71.3% increase in Q4 revenue, totaling $427.7 million. Despite strong financial performance, Reddit’s stock dropped by 15.1%.
